Where to inject insulin pens?

Where should I inject my insulin pen into my body?Recommended injection sites include Abdomen, front and sides of thighs, upper and outer arms, and buttocks. Do not inject near joints, groin area, navel, mid-abdomen, or scar tissue.

Where is the best place to inject insulin?

There are several parts of the body where insulin can be injected:

  • The abdomen, at least 5 cm (2 inches) from the navel. The abdomen is the best place to inject insulin. …
  • Front of thigh. Insulin is usually absorbed more slowly from this site. …
  • The back of the upper arm.
  • upper buttocks.

Do I need to pinch my skin when using an insulin pen?

Insulin injections should go into the fatty layer of the skin (called the « subcutaneous » or « SC » tissue). Insert the needle straight at a 90-degree angle. You don’t have to pinch the skin unless you use a longer needle (6.8 to 12.7 mm).

Do I need to prepare an insulin pen?

Prime the insulin pen. Priming means removing air bubbles from the needle and making sure the needle is open and working. Pen must be ready before each injection.

How many times can you use an insulin pen needle?

Use only insulin pen needles once; It should be removed and discarded after injection.

Do insulin pens need to be refrigerated?

Refrigerate the insulin pen until you open it; After that, you can store it at room temperature. Ask your doctor if your specific insulin has a shorter or longer lifespan. Some insulins must be used in as little as 10 days. If you suspect your insulin has ever been frozen, you should not use it.

Can I refill the insulin pen?

Reusable pen contains replaceable insulin cartridges. Discard the ink cartridge when it is empty. Then put in a new prefilled cartridge. Use a new needle every time you inject insulin.

Why do lumps grow after insulin injections?

Scar tissue or hardened areas may also form at the site. This can happen to anyone who takes insulin, whether it’s delivered via a syringe or an insulin pump.it happens because Effects of insulin on fat cells, as insulin causes fat cells to increase in size.
